    Decided to switch our date night up and take a painting class at VinoArtist with my fiancé! Asides we're an unartistic duo-- we've had this in our to-do bucket list as a couple. Since VinoArtist offers different themes each class for you to recreate, we went with the "You and I" painting which is a couple admiring a sunset at a beach. If my fiancé and I were to be a masterpiece, it would be exactly that since we both love the beach and watching sunsets during spring/summer. As advertised once we arrived we were given art supplies along with aprons and a station with our canvas. Before class started, our instructor told us they had some snacks and alcohol for sale to eat and sip during class. So glad we brought our own bottle and charcuterie-- the pours seemed small and snack selection wasn't the best! Throughout the class we were guided step by step but midway through the couples seated next to us including ourselves had a hard time catching up since the instructor decided to speed up. Definitely was a challenge for most of us beginners but a great experience. For those who didn't get to finish once he was done with the class he gave the option to stay for a bit to add finishing touches or catch up. The end product forsure didn't turn out as shown on the website which is okay since you're supposed -- but we did a pretty good job or should I saw my fiancé did. My takeaway would be that this was a fun experience however I felt the instructor we had was a bit of a miss for us.

    Went here recently for a team building event. This place can be tough to find since it's inside a business building nestled in a little room on the third floor. After overcoming the hurdle of locating the actual place, everything was cool. We were able to bring in our own finger food and drinks (which included wine too). The instructor was fairly new (only two months on the job) but was very patient. Each person gets a station with an apron, thick and skinny paint brushes, a paper plate (for the paint), water cup, napkin, and a canvas sitting on an easel. There is a painting chosen before the class begins and your goal is to recreate that image onto your own canvas. Thankfully you're not on your own since there is an instructor that will guide you step by step as you're painting. It's a fun experience and I didn't realize how challenging painting can be. Recommend doing this for a date night!

    I had been wanting to go to a paint-and-sip event for a long time; it was one of the activities I…read morepictured adults frequently doing when I was a teenager. I finally got to try this out last summer, and first I'll just say, it was a little pricier than I expected it to be. There's usually a Groupon for this event, and even with that you're paying around $30/person, so I suggest checking that out before buying your ticket. It doesn't come with any drinks, so you'll have to pay additional prices for those. Paint Nite works by you selecting the night you want to attend the event on their website. They have multiple Bay Area cities, with an almost endless list of locations in each where the events will take place. They have multiple events per week, and each night is a different location and example painting. If you bought a Groupon, you'll enter it during the payment stage. All pretty self-explanatory. Along with being more expensive than I imagined, it's also much less glamorous. When I was younger, I thought these nights would be held at a studio or someone's home, with the wine being supplied (and not being super cheap). I really wasn't a fan of the Grill 'Em Restaurant we went to, because it's the quality of Chili's or Applebee's. I knew there wouldn't be decent wine at a decent price, so I ordered two cocktails instead. Unfortunately those were so sweet, they made me feel ill afterward. The food wasn't too good either...but that's a review for their business, not this one. I brought an old friend with me when I went, and he decided to do his own thing and painted something from Twin Peaks. The instructor was funny and knew how to explain painting to first-time painters who were pretty tipsy. Our class was mostly a large group of women who were celebrating one of their birthdays, and they were mostly all drunk and very loud. I probably wouldn't pay this much to paint again, but I certainly wouldn't choose the location we had again. It's fun to do once, though.
